What is the best bicycle route from Zurich to Luzern? I see that
national bicycle route 9 will take me from Zug to Luzern. So perhaps
I just need a good route from Zurich to Zug. In which case some tips
on finding national bicycle route 9 once in Zug would be welcome also.

Or maybe there is a better route and I should skip the national
bicycle routes altogether?

I'd just get a map when you're there and see what looks interesting. The
whole country is so bicycle friendly that you will have a hard time
finding a bad route.

For example, you might go down the west side of the lake and pick up
route 9 where it intersects. Or, if you want to go a little farther, go
down the east side of the lake and pick up route 9 in Rapperswil. Even
that route's probably less than 45 miles.

There is a range of fairly steep hills just west of the lake, which you
have to get over. Any of the locals should be able to tell you what's
the easiest route over them. Probably the national route will be among
the flattest options, and very scenic.

I've always ridden to Affoltern a. A. and crossed the Reuss valley to
Muri on RTE 25, then to Gisikon and RTE 4 that take you into Lucerne.
This route has a good agricultural/bicycle paved road parallel to the
main route. From Gisikon it's a main route with shoulders and plenty
of room until you enter Lucerne.

By the way, as you drop down to Lucerne, you'll come past the grand
Museum that depicts ancient wars but across from which is the
wonderful glacier garden and Lucerne Lion Sculpture with reflecting
pool.

You can buy special maps for cyclists. These maps have bicycle-friendly
routes marked out in red. If you arrive at the main train station in
Zurich you can buy them right there in the newspaper shop/kiosk in the
main hall. Unfortunately rather expensive--CHF 26. Also you would want
to have more than one.
